2. What are cookies?

Cookies are small text files that are downloaded to your device (computer, mobile phone, tablet, etc.) when you browse a website. They are used to store and retrieve information about your visit, such as your browsing preferences or device type, and can facilitate certain features (for example, keeping you logged in or remembering shopping cart contents). Some cookies allow users to be identified or identifiable and create behavioral profiles; therefore, when their use involves the processing of personal data, they must comply with the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and regulations on information society services.

3.1. Necessary or technical cookies

These cookies are essential for the Website to function properly and to provide the services you request (for example, managing the purchasing process, remembering products added to your shopping cart, enabling login, or ensuring secure browsing). These cookies allow communication between your device and our network and are used to provide services specifically requested. They do not require your prior consent, although we do inform you of their existence for transparency purposes.

3.2. Preference or personalization cookies

They allow us to remember information so you can access the service with certain characteristics that distinguish your experience from that of other users (for example, language, number of results displayed, browser type, or region from which you access the service). When these cookies are installed because you select these preferences yourself, they are exempt from requesting consent because they respond to a service you have specifically requested.

3.3. Analytical or measurement cookies

They help us understand how users navigate our website and measure activity and performance, with the aim of improving our services and content. To do this, they compile aggregated anonymous statistics (for example, pages visited, time spent on the website, or loading errors). According to the Spanish Data Protection Agency (AEPD), these cookies are not exempt from the duty to provide information and require the user's consent before installation.

3.4. Behavioral advertising cookies

They store information about your browsing habits, obtained through continuous observation, which allows for the creation of a specific profile and the display of personalized advertising tailored to your interests. These cookies always require your prior consent.

3.5. Social cookies

These cookies are used by social networks (such as Facebook, Instagram, or Twitter) to allow you to share content and are only installed when you interact with the embedded content on these platforms. They are managed by third parties and may collect information about your activity on other websites. They require your consent.

3.6. According to the entity that manages them

  • First-party cookies : These are sent to your device from our own domain and managed by Trendy Hair to provide the services you request (for example, remembering your shopping preferences).

  • Third-party cookies : These are sent to your device from domains not managed by us, but by collaborating entities that process the data obtained (for example, Google for analytical services or social networks for sharing content).

3.7. Depending on the length of time they remain activated

  • Session cookies : These collect and store data while you browse our website and are deleted when you close your browser.

  • Persistent cookies : Data remains stored on your device for a period defined by the data controller (which can range from a few minutes to several years). For privacy reasons, we recommend that their duration be the minimum necessary for the purpose for which they are used.
